PowerMac B&W G3 with MAC OS 8.5.1 need to be upgrading to 9.1. Install need to upgrade firmware. But it could not be completed because finder coud not see firmware update file. Now MAc starts from hard disk with the old 8.5.1 and can not start from CD. It also does not react on pressing interrupt button (nothing happpened). Zapping PRAM does not help. It looks like firmware contents is corrupt. But this MAC has file ROM.
So how to manage MAC to boot it from CD again?
thanks
 
Try starting up from the hard drive, then, in control panel, select startup device and click the CD, then restart.
